Story Behind the Art:
Founded in 1999, Old-Modern Handicrafts (OMH) is a leading factory in manufacturing high quality wooden ship models. OMH started with about 20 popular models such as the RMS Titanic and the USS Constitution. As of 2011, OMH has more than 1,000 different models including historic tall ships, ancient boats, modern speed boats, modern cruise ships, yachts, and warships. OMH is widely supported around the world with its eye catching, easy to display, and affordable ship models. These models are proudly displayed in many homes, offices, luxurious galleries, and museums around the world.
